Rail Connectivity Push: Ranchi-Ara Express Extension Sought

LJP (RV) leader Birendra Pradhan met with officials to advocate for extending the Ranchi-Ara express railway line to Buxar, aiming to improve regional transportation links and connectivity for commuters in the area.

Heavy Rain Alert: Schools Shut in Nearby UP Cities

Schools across five Uttar Pradesh cities have been closed due to landslides affecting the Rishikesh-Uttarkashi region, with heavy rain alerts also issued for Odisha and Jharkhand, signaling potential weather impacts across the broader eastern region.

India Mediating Ukraine-Russia Conflict

India's External Affairs Minister stated that the country is actively working with both Moscow and Kyiv to facilitate an end to the ongoing war, positioning India as a diplomatic intermediary in the conflict.

J&K Statehood Restoration Discussed

Omar Abdullah, chief of Jammu and Kashmir, met with Union Home Minister Amit Shah to discuss the early restoration of the region's statehood status, signaling progress on a key political issue.

India Secures 70% of Crude Oil Outside Hormuz Strait

India's Petroleum Ministry confirmed that the country has secured 70% of its crude oil imports from sources outside the Strait of Hormuz, reducing dependence on a critical chokepoint and enhancing energy security.

RBI Holds Repo Rate; GDP Growth Projected at 6.9%

The Reserve Bank of India kept the repo rate unchanged while projecting India's real GDP growth for the current fiscal year at 6.9%, signaling a measured monetary policy stance amid economic conditions.

PM Modi Calls for Economic Self-Reliance

Prime Minister Narendra Modi made seven appeals for economic self-reliance, emphasizing India's need to reduce external dependencies and strengthen domestic capabilities across key sectors.

ISRO Launches First Imaging Satellite

India's space agency ISRO successfully launched its first imaging satellite into orbit, advancing the country's capabilities in earth observation and satellite technology.

Air India Pilot Sacked Over Drug Test Failure

Air India terminated a Phuket flight pilot who tested positive for a psychoactive substance, with investigation reports confirming the positive result and triggering immediate action on safety grounds.

Bengaluru Woman Assaulted Over Loan Repayment; 4 Arrested

Four individuals were arrested after a Bengaluru woman was stripped, assaulted, and filmed in connection with a loan repayment dispute, with SC/ST and POCSO Acts invoked in the case.

Influencer Detained for Violence at Protest

An influencer who bragged about assaulting a student's father at a CJP protest was detained, with SC/ST and POCSO Acts invoked against the individual for the alleged incident.

Delhi Airport Waterlogging After Heavy Rain

Delhi International Airport experienced significant waterlogging following heavy rainfall, highlighting drainage and infrastructure challenges during monsoon conditions.

PG Raids in Bengaluru Uncover Hygiene Violations

Raids at 64 paying guest accommodations in Bengaluru revealed expired food items and pest control powder stored alongside food supplies, raising serious health and safety concerns.

Wanted Man Hid in Pond to Evade Police

A Karnataka man wanted in 16 cases attempted to hide in a pond to avoid arrest but was ultimately apprehended by police, demonstrating the limits of such evasion tactics.

India-Japan Historic T20I Cricket Match

India and Japan are set to play a historic T20 International cricket match in Sano, marking a significant moment in bilateral sporting relations.

India's June Quarter GDP Faces Scrutiny

India's June quarter GDP figures have drawn controversy and debate among economists regarding their accuracy and implications for the broader economic outlook.

Revenge killing: 3 held for auto driver murder

Police arrested three suspects in connection with the murder of an auto driver in Hyderabad, with revenge cited as the motive.

EAGLE Force seizes 12 kg ganja shipment

Law enforcement intercepted a drug trafficking operation, catching two individuals transporting 12 kilograms of ganja destined for Hyderabad.

Hyderabad west drives Telangana's tax revenue

Western Hyderabad has emerged as the primary tax revenue generator for Telangana state, anchoring the region's fiscal performance.

High court battles 2.2 lakh pending cases

Telangana High Court faces severe case backlog of 2.2 lakh pending matters, exacerbated by a shortage of judges impacting judicial delivery.

AI-led taxpayer monitoring in Telangana

Telangana has implemented artificial intelligence systems to monitor and track taxpayer compliance, modernizing revenue administration.

KRMB halts Srisailam water releases

Krishna River Management Board directed Telangana to stop water releases from Srisailam, likely due to inter-state water-sharing protocols.

HC orders R&R assessment for Mallannasagar oustees

High Court directed the state to evaluate rehabilitation and resettlement benefits for people displaced by the Mallannasagar project.

E-cigarette sales busted in two stores

EAGLE Force raided and shut down illegal e-cigarette sales operations at two retail locations in Hyderabad.

Apollyon Dynamics sets speed record with Ahuti Mk II

Hyderabad-based defence-tech startup Apollyon Dynamics achieved a certified top speed of 498 km/h with its electric multirotor interceptor, entering the India Book of Records.

Mailardevpally Police arrest in Rs 24.49 lakh burglary

Police arrested a former worker in connection with a burglary case involving Rs 24.49 lakh in stolen goods.

JNTU students clash during Teej celebrations

Eight students were detained after a clash erupted during Teej festival celebrations at JNTU Hyderabad campus.

Telangana to celebrate Teachers' Day outside Hyderabad

For the first time, Telangana will hold its Teachers' Day celebrations at a venue outside Hyderabad, marking a shift in state-level event planning.

Railways Cancel 8 Trains as Ground Subsidence Halts North Bengal Services

Indian Railways has cancelled 8 trains operating in West Bengal after ground subsidence was detected near Farakka and in Maldah Division following heavy rainfall. Track infrastructure damage has temporarily halted north Bengal-bound train services, affecting passenger connectivity in the region.

Track Subsidence Near Farakka Causes Multi-Hour Service Disruption

A subsidence incident near Farakka has caused significant delays and service halts for trains traveling through north Bengal. The infrastructure damage required emergency response and temporary suspension of rail operations in the affected corridor.

President-Elect Kemo Ceesay Takes Administrative Control of GFF

President-elect Kemo Ceesay has assumed administrative authority of the Gambia Football Federation (GFF), signaling organizational changes ahead of his administration.

Gambia U17 Team Departs for Senegal WAFU A AFCON Qualifier

The Gambian U17 national football team has departed for Senegal to participate in the WAFU A AFCON qualifier tournament.

Africell Sponsors Nawettan Teams with Jerseys

Telecommunications company Africell has provided jerseys to nawettan (traditional wrestling) teams, supporting local sports culture and community engagement.

Army Chief to Deploy Troops to New Upper River Region Post

The Gambian Army chief has announced plans to deploy military personnel to a newly established post in the Upper River Region (URR), strengthening security infrastructure.

NDI Warns 2026 Election Credibility Critical to Democratic Future

The National Democratic Institute (NDI) has cautioned that the credibility and integrity of the 2026 elections will be decisive in determining the trajectory of Gambia's democratic development.

Gambia Transitions to 9-Digit Mobile Numbers; Africell Expands Capacity to 100 Million

The Gambian telecommunications sector is migrating to a 9-digit mobile numbering system, with Africell expanding its number capacity to 100 million subscribers to accommodate future growth.

WADR Forum: Gambia's Reforms Must Translate Into Public Trust

Speakers at the West African Democracy and Rights (WADR) Forum emphasized that Gambia's ongoing institutional reforms must be accompanied by tangible improvements in public confidence and trust.

FAO and Agriculture Ministry Launch Youth and Women Agribusiness Projects

The Food and Agriculture Organization (FAO) and Gambia's Ministry of Agriculture have jointly launched initiatives to support youth and women entrepreneurs in the agribusiness sector.

Matty Jobe Named Face of Gambia International Fashion Week 2026

Matty Jobe has been unveiled as the official ambassador for the Gambia International Fashion Week 2026, representing the country's fashion and cultural identity.

Ambassador Kah Secures Landmark Cooperation at China's Big Data Expo

Gambia's Ambassador Kah delivered a keynote address at China's Big Data Expo 2026 and secured a significant cooperation agreement with Guizhou University, advancing digital and educational partnerships.

Food Safety Critical to Unlocking Gambia's Cashew Export Potential

Industry experts have highlighted that strengthening food safety standards and compliance is essential for Gambia to maximize its cashew export opportunities and access international markets.

Senegalese Tourism Professionals Impressed by Gambia's Eco-Tourism Prospects

A delegation of Senegalese tourism professionals has expressed strong interest in Gambia's eco-tourism potential, signaling regional cooperation opportunities in sustainable tourism development.

4.5km Sanyang Beach Side Road Inaugurated to Boost Coastal Economy

A new 4.5-kilometer beach-side road in Sanyang has been inaugurated, with the President stating it will enhance economic activity and development in the coastal region.

India's Forex Reserves Hit Fresh Record

Dollar deposits have pushed India's foreign exchange reserves to a fresh record high for the week ended August 28, strengthening the nation's external financial position.

Supreme Court Quashes Jantar Mantar Protest FIRs

The Supreme Court has quashed FIRs related to Jantar Mantar protests across India but permits fresh FIR against 2,873 individuals, balancing protest rights with legal accountability.
